Transaction 618761b041084fb268c19e9ad4874254250cf8d1819abe18ed7077a1369f7a5e
1 Input
1 Output
-
618761b041084fb268c19e9ad4874254250cf8d1819abe18ed7077a1369f7a5e:0
- value
- 76385
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b6603977e8e92b9f864df990d3bd58f718e9b3f
- address
- bc1qednq89m736ftn7rym7vs6w743accaxel3x7dy0